We are seeking an experienced administrative assistant with a minimum of 3 years of experience in the mutual fund industry to join our fast-paced financial services firm. As an integral member of our team, you will provide essential administrative support to ensure the smooth operation of our day-to-day activities.

**Responsibilities**:

- Assist with the coordination and execution of administrative tasks, including managing calendars, scheduling meetings, and making travel arrangements.
- Prepare and edit correspondence, reports, presentations, and other documents.
- Maintain and update confidential client records, ensuring accuracy and compliance with regulatory requirements.
- Conduct research and gather information to support investment strategies and decision-making processes.
- Assist with the preparation and distribution of marketing materials and client communications.
- Collaborate with team members to ensure seamless communication and coordination.
- Handle incoming calls and inquiries, providing exceptional customer service to clients and stakeholders.
- Manage and prioritize multiple tasks, projects, and de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
- Proactively identify opportunities to streamline processes and improve operational efficiency.

**Qualifications**:

- Minimum of 3 years of experience as an administrative assistant in the mutual fund industry.
- Strong knowledge of mutual funds and familiarity with regulatory requirements.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ook) and other relevant software.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ills, with the ability to prioritize tasks effectively.
-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y in all aspects of work.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.
- Proven ability to handle sensitive and confidential information with discretion.
- Flexibility to adapt to changing priorities and deadlines.
- Positive attitude, strong work ethic, and a willingness to take on new challenges.
